A New Strategy of Constructing Mechanical Enhanced and Electrical Conductive Meta-aramid/Polyacrylonitrile Hybrid Fibers

Abstract Proper method for constructing electrical conductive m-aramid fibers without sacrificing its excellent integrated performance is still a challenge. Here a new strategy is utilized to construct electrical conductive PMIA/PAN hybrid fibers. No sensitizers or activators are needed in this method, contrast to traditional electroless plating methods. Specifically, the resulted PMIA/PAN hybrid fibers maintained a high tensile strength of 4.7 cN/dtex. Furthermore, the CuS-coated PMIA/PAN hybrid fibers (PMIA/PAN-CuS) exhibited high conductivity.
